| 62 | /** | 
|---|
| 63 | @brief Splits a string into multiple tokens. | 
|---|
| 64 | @param line The line to split | 
|---|
| 65 | @param delimiters Multiple characters at which to split the line | 
|---|
| 66 | @param delimiterNeighbours Neighbours of the delimiters that will be erased as well (for example white-spaces) | 
|---|
| 67 | @param bAllowEmptyEntries If true, empty tokens are also added to the SubString (if there are two delimiters without a char in between) | 
|---|
| 68 | @param escapeChar The escape character that is used to escape safemode chars (for example if you want to use a quotation mark between two other quotation marks). | 
|---|
| 69 | @param bRemoveEscapeChar If true, the escape char is removed from the tokens | 
|---|
| 70 | @param safemodeChar Within these characters splitting won't happen (usually the quotation marks) | 
|---|
| 71 | @param bRemoveSafemodeChar Removes the safemodeChar from the beginning and the ending of a token | 
|---|
| 72 | @param openparenthesisChar The beginning of a safemode is marked with this (usually an opening brace) | 
|---|
| 73 | @param closeparenthesisChar The ending of a safemode is marked with this (usually a closing brace) | 
|---|
| 74 | @param bRemoveParenthesisChars Removes the parenthesis chars from the beginning and the ending of a token | 
|---|
| 75 | @param commentChar The comment character (used to ignore the part of the line after the comment char). | 
|---|
| 76 | */ | 
|---|
| 77 | SubString::SubString(const std::string& line, | 
|---|
| 78 | const std::string& delimiters, const std::string& delimiterNeighbours, bool bAllowEmptyEntries, | 
|---|
| 79 | char escapeChar, bool bRemoveEscapeChar, char safemodeChar, bool bRemoveSafemodeChar, | 
|---|
| 80 | char openparenthesisChar, char closeparenthesisChar, bool bRemoveParenthesisChars, char commentChar) | 
|---|
| 81 | { | 
|---|
| 82 | SubString::splitLine(this->tokens_, this->bTokenInSafemode_, line, delimiters, delimiterNeighbours, bAllowEmptyEntries, escapeChar, bRemoveEscapeChar, safemodeChar, bRemoveSafemodeChar, openparenthesisChar, closeparenthesisChar, bRemoveParenthesisChars, commentChar); | 
|---|
| 83 | } |

| 270 |  | 
|---|
| 271 | /** | 
|---|
| 272 | @copydoc SubString(const std::string&,const std::string&,const std::string&,bool,char,bool,char,bool,char,char,bool,char) | 
|---|
| 273 | @param tokens The array, where the splitted strings will be stored in | 
|---|
| 274 | @param bTokenInSafemode A vector wich stores for each character of the string if it is in safemode or not | 
|---|
| 275 | @param start_state The internal state of the parser | 
|---|
| 276 |  | 
|---|
| 277 | This is the actual splitting algorithm from Clemens Wacha. | 
|---|
| 278 | Supports delimiters, escape characters, ignores special characters between safemodeChar and between commentChar and line end "\n". | 
|---|
| 279 |  | 
|---|
| 280 | Extended by Orxonox to support parenthesis as additional safe-mode. | 
|---|
| 281 | */ | 
|---|
| 282 | SubString::SPLIT_LINE_STATE | 
|---|
| 283 | SubString::splitLine(std::vector<std::string>& tokens, | 
|---|
| 284 | std::vector<bool>& bTokenInSafemode, | 
|---|
| 285 | const std::string& line, | 
|---|
| 286 | const std::string& delimiters, | 
|---|
| 287 | const std::string& delimiterNeighbours, | 
|---|
| 288 | bool bAllowEmptyEntries, | 
|---|
| 289 | char escapeChar, | 
|---|
| 290 | bool bRemoveEscapeChar, | 
|---|
| 291 | char safemodeChar, | 
|---|
| 292 | bool bRemoveSafemodeChar, | 
|---|
| 293 | char openparenthesisChar, | 
|---|
| 294 | char closeparenthesisChar, | 
|---|
| 295 | bool bRemoveParenthesisChars, | 
|---|
| 296 | char commentChar, | 
|---|
| 297 | SPLIT_LINE_STATE start_state) | 
|---|
| 298 | { | 
|---|
| 299 | SPLIT_LINE_STATE state = start_state; | 
|---|
| 300 | unsigned int i = 0; | 
|---|
| 301 | unsigned int f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 302 |  | 
|---|
| 303 | std::string token; | 
|---|
| 304 | bool inSafemode = false; | 
|---|
| 305 |  | 
|---|
| 306 | if(start_state != SL_NORMAL && tokens.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 307 | { | 
|---|
| 308 | token = tokens[tokens.size()-1]; | 
|---|
| 309 | tokens.pop_back(); | 
|---|
| 310 | } | 
|---|
| 311 | if(start_state != SL_NORMAL && bTokenInSafemode.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 312 | { | 
|---|
| 313 | inSafemode = bTokenInSafemode[bTokenInSafemode.size()-1]; | 
|---|
| 314 | bTokenInSafemode.pop_back(); | 
|---|
| 315 | } | 
|---|
| 316 |  | 
|---|
| 317 | while(i < line.size()) | 
|---|
| 318 | { | 
|---|
| 319 | switch(state) | 
|---|
| 320 | { | 
|---|
| 321 | case SL_NORMAL: | 
|---|
| 322 | if(line[i] == escapeChar) | 
|---|
| 323 | { | 
|---|
| 324 | state = SL_ESCAPE; | 
|---|
| 325 | if (!bRemoveEscapeChar) | 
|---|
| 326 | token += line[i]; | 
|---|
| 327 | f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 328 | } | 
|---|
| 329 | else if(line[i] == safemodeChar) | 
|---|
| 330 | { | 
|---|
| 331 | state = SL_SAFEMODE; | 
|---|
| 332 | inSafemode = true; | 
|---|
| 333 | if (!bRemoveSafemodeChar) | 
|---|
| 334 | token += line[i]; | 
|---|
| 335 | f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 336 | } | 
|---|
| 337 | else if(line[i] == openparenthesisChar) | 
|---|
| 338 | { | 
|---|
| 339 | state = SL_PARENTHESES; | 
|---|
| 340 | inSafemode = true; | 
|---|
| 341 | if (!bRemoveParenthesisChars) | 
|---|
| 342 | token += line[i]; | 
|---|
| 343 | f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 344 | } | 
|---|
| 345 | else if(line[i] == commentChar) | 
|---|
| 346 | { | 
|---|
| 347 | if (fallBackNeighbours > 0) | 
|---|
| 348 | token = token.substr(0, token.size() - fallBackNeighbours); | 
|---|
| 349 | f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 350 | // FINISH | 
|---|
| 351 | if(bAllowEmptyEntries || token.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 352 | { | 
|---|
| 353 | tokens.push_back(token); | 
|---|
| 354 | token.clear(); | 
|---|
| 355 | bTokenInSafemode.push_back(inSafemode); | 
|---|
| 356 | inSafemode = false; | 
|---|
| 357 | } | 
|---|
| 358 | token += line[i];       // EAT | 
|---|
| 359 | state = SL_COMMENT; | 
|---|
| 360 | } | 
|---|
| 361 | else if(delimiters.find(line[i]) != std::string::npos) | 
|---|
| 362 | { | 
|---|
| 363 | // line[i] is a delimiter | 
|---|
| 364 | if (fallBackNeighbours > 0) | 
|---|
| 365 | token = token.substr(0, token.size() - fallBackNeighbours); | 
|---|
| 366 | f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 367 | // FINISH | 
|---|
| 368 | if(bAllowEmptyEntries || token.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 369 | { | 
|---|
| 370 | tokens.push_back(token); | 
|---|
| 371 | token.clear(); | 
|---|
| 372 | bTokenInSafemode.push_back(inSafemode); | 
|---|
| 373 | inSafemode = false; | 
|---|
| 374 | } | 
|---|
| 375 | state = SL_NORMAL; | 
|---|
| 376 | } | 
|---|
| 377 | else | 
|---|
| 378 | { | 
|---|
| 379 | if (delimiterNeighbours.find(line[i]) != std::string::npos) | 
|---|
| 380 | { | 
|---|
| 381 | if (token.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 382 | ++fallBackNeighbours; | 
|---|
| 383 | else | 
|---|
| 384 | { | 
|---|
| 385 | ++i; | 
|---|
| 386 | continue; | 
|---|
| 387 | } | 
|---|
| 388 | } | 
|---|
| 389 | else | 
|---|
| 390 | fallBackNeighbours = 0; | 
|---|
| 391 | token += line[i];       // EAT | 
|---|
| 392 | } | 
|---|
| 393 | break; | 
|---|
| 394 | case SL_ESCAPE: | 
|---|
| 395 | if (!bRemoveSafemodeChar) | 
|---|
| 396 | token += line[i]; | 
|---|
| 397 | else | 
|---|
| 398 | { | 
|---|
| 399 | if(line[i] == 'n') token += '\n'; | 
|---|
| 400 | else if(line[i] == 't') token += '\t'; | 
|---|
| 401 | else if(line[i] == 'v') token += '\v'; | 
|---|
| 402 | else if(line[i] == 'b') token += '\b'; | 
|---|
| 403 | else if(line[i] == 'r') token += '\r'; | 
|---|
| 404 | else if(line[i] == 'f') token += '\f'; | 
|---|
| 405 | else if(line[i] == 'a') token += '\a'; | 
|---|
| 406 | else if(line[i] == '?') token += '\?'; | 
|---|
| 407 | else token += line[i];  // EAT | 
|---|
| 408 | } | 
|---|
| 409 | state = SL_NORMAL; | 
|---|
| 410 | break; | 
|---|
| 411 | case SL_SAFEMODE: | 
|---|
| 412 | if(line[i] == safemodeChar) | 
|---|
| 413 | { | 
|---|
| 414 | state = SL_NORMAL; | 
|---|
| 415 | if (!bRemoveSafemodeChar) | 
|---|
| 416 | token += line[i]; | 
|---|
| 417 | } | 
|---|
| 418 | else if(line[i] == escapeChar) | 
|---|
| 419 | { | 
|---|
| 420 | state = SL_SAFEESCAPE; | 
|---|
| 421 | } | 
|---|
| 422 | else | 
|---|
| 423 | { | 
|---|
| 424 | token += line[i];       // EAT | 
|---|
| 425 | } | 
|---|
| 426 | break; | 
|---|
| 427 |  | 
|---|
| 428 | case SL_SAFEESCAPE: | 
|---|
| 429 | if(line[i] == 'n') token += '\n'; | 
|---|
| 430 | else if(line[i] == 't') token += '\t'; | 
|---|
| 431 | else if(line[i] == 'v') token += '\v'; | 
|---|
| 432 | else if(line[i] == 'b') token += '\b'; | 
|---|
| 433 | else if(line[i] == 'r') token += '\r'; | 
|---|
| 434 | else if(line[i] == 'f') token += '\f'; | 
|---|
| 435 | else if(line[i] == 'a') token += '\a'; | 
|---|
| 436 | else if(line[i] == '?') token += '\?'; | 
|---|
| 437 | else token += line[i];  // EAT | 
|---|
| 438 | state = SL_SAFEMODE; | 
|---|
| 439 | break; | 
|---|
| 440 |  | 
|---|
| 441 | case SL_PARENTHESES: | 
|---|
| 442 | if(line[i] == closeparenthesisChar) | 
|---|
| 443 | { | 
|---|
| 444 | state = SL_NORMAL; | 
|---|
| 445 | if (!bRemoveParenthesisChars) | 
|---|
| 446 | token += line[i]; | 
|---|
| 447 | } | 
|---|
| 448 | else if(line[i] == escapeChar) | 
|---|
| 449 | { | 
|---|
| 450 | state = SL_PARENTHESESESCAPE; | 
|---|
| 451 | } | 
|---|
| 452 | else | 
|---|
| 453 | { | 
|---|
| 454 | token += line[i];       // EAT | 
|---|
| 455 | } | 
|---|
| 456 | break; | 
|---|
| 457 |  | 
|---|
| 458 | case SL_PARENTHESESESCAPE: | 
|---|
| 459 | if(line[i] == 'n') token += '\n'; | 
|---|
| 460 | else if(line[i] == 't') token += '\t'; | 
|---|
| 461 | else if(line[i] == 'v') token += '\v'; | 
|---|
| 462 | else if(line[i] == 'b') token += '\b'; | 
|---|
| 463 | else if(line[i] == 'r') token += '\r'; | 
|---|
| 464 | else if(line[i] == 'f') token += '\f'; | 
|---|
| 465 | else if(line[i] == 'a') token += '\a'; | 
|---|
| 466 | else if(line[i] == '?') token += '\?'; | 
|---|
| 467 | else token += line[i];  // EAT | 
|---|
| 468 | state = SL_PARENTHESES; | 
|---|
| 469 | break; | 
|---|
| 470 |  | 
|---|
| 471 | case SL_COMMENT: | 
|---|
| 472 | if(line[i] == '\n') | 
|---|
| 473 | { | 
|---|
| 474 | // FINISH | 
|---|
| 475 | if(token.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 476 | { | 
|---|
| 477 | tokens.push_back(token); | 
|---|
| 478 | token.clear(); | 
|---|
| 479 | bTokenInSafemode.push_back(inSafemode); | 
|---|
| 480 | inSafemode = false; | 
|---|
| 481 | } | 
|---|
| 482 | state = SL_NORMAL; | 
|---|
| 483 | } | 
|---|
| 484 | else | 
|---|
| 485 | { | 
|---|
| 486 | token += line[i];       // EAT | 
|---|
| 487 | } | 
|---|
| 488 | break; | 
|---|
| 489 |  | 
|---|
| 490 | default: | 
|---|
| 491 | // nothing | 
|---|
| 492 | break; | 
|---|
| 493 | } | 
|---|
| 494 | ++i; | 
|---|
| 495 | } | 
|---|
| 496 |  | 
|---|
| 497 | // FINISH | 
|---|
| 498 | if (fallBackNeighbours > 0) | 
|---|
| 499 | token = token.substr(0, token.size() - fallBackNeighbours); | 
|---|
| 500 | if(bAllowEmptyEntries || token.size() > 0) | 
|---|
| 501 | { | 
|---|
| 502 | tokens.push_back(token); | 
|---|
| 503 | token.clear(); | 
|---|
| 504 | bTokenInSafemode.push_back(inSafemode); | 
|---|
| 505 | inSafemode = false; | 
|---|
| 506 | } | 
|---|
| 507 | return(state); | 
|---|
| 508 | } |
